Batcmd
batcmd.com › windows › 10 › services › hidbatt
HID UPS Battery Driver - Windows 10 Service - batcmd.com
Hid Battery Driver by Microsoft Corporation. This service also exists in Windows 11 and 8. The HID UPS Battery Driver service is a kernel mode driver. If HID UPS Battery Driver fails to start, the error is logged.
Driverscape
driverscape.com › download › hid-ups-battery
HID UPS Battery Drivers Download for Windows 10, 8.1, 7, Vista, XP
Use the links on this page to download the latest version of HID UPS Battery drivers. All drivers available for download have been scanned by antivirus program.
windows - HID power device driver for UPS with serial port - Stack Overflow
I have a UPS which outputs data, like battery status, via serial port. This UPS is connected to a computer via USB, using a serial port to USB adapter. Communication with the UPS is possible with hyper terminal via a custom protocol. Is it possible to write a HID power device driver for Windows ... More on stackoverflow.com
Reverse engineering UPS battery status USB HID protocol with Linux
It's an interesting thing to do, and I applaud you for doing it... but the NUT software has supported this UPS for quite a while, AFAIK. https://www.reddit.com/r/homelab/comments/lzelya/working_nut_config_for_cyberpower_ups/ More on reddit.com
Desktop PC w/UPS, but Windows 11 not seeing UPS any more.
Fixed: I deleted the CyperPower Device from Device Manager, then rebooted. Windows discovered the UPS device and put it's driver in for it. Device Mgr->Batteries now has 'HID UPS Battery' and the Power options are back in Settings. More on reddit.com
Generic UPS with USB. How to find the good driver?
Have you tried the generic `usbhid` driver? More on reddit.com
Batcmd
batcmd.com › windows › 7 › services › hidbatt
HID UPS Battery Driver - Windows 7 Service - batcmd.com
Hid Battery Driver by Microsoft Corporation. This service also exists in Windows 10, 11 and 8. The HID UPS Battery Driver service is a kernel driver. If the HID UPS Battery Driver fails to load or initialize, the error is recorded into the Event Log.
Revert Service
revertservice.com › 10 › hidbatt
HID UPS Battery Driver (HidBatt) Service Defaults in Windows 10
Hid Battery Driver by Microsoft Corporation. HID UPS Battery Driver is a kernel device driver. In Windows 10 it is starting only if the user, an application or another service starts it. If HID UPS Battery Driver fails to start, the failure details are being recorded into Event Log.
DriverMax
drivermax.com › driver › update › Battery › Microsoft › HID-UPS-Battery
DriverMax - Battery - Microsoft - HID UPS Battery Computer Driver Updates
Update your computer's drivers using DriverMax, the free driver update tool - Battery - Microsoft - HID UPS Battery Computer Driver Updates
Batcmd
batcmd.com › windows › 11 › services › hidbatt
HID UPS Battery Driver - Windows 11 Service - batcmd.com
The HID UPS Battery Driver service is a kernel mode driver. If HID UPS Battery Driver fails to start, the error is logged.
DriverIdentifier
driveridentifier.com › scan › hid-ups-battery › driver-detail › 5B1BAB8186A346DE8749404A3F1D285F › 4632441 › 5e996b17e8d8b3edd199b50c8a3c9d73 › 246852720 › HID_DEVICE_UP:0084_U:0004
HID UPS Battery Driver Download For XP,VISTA,WIN7,WIN8,WIN81,WIN10/64bits - Hewlett-Packard H8-1380t
Download Latest HID UPS Battery driver for windows 7, vista,xp,windows8 . it's for H8-1380t
RunOnPC
runonpc.com › hid-ups-battery-driver-downloads-update
Microsoft HID UPS Battery driver download and product parameters information
The name of the driver type in the system is: Battery, and the drive type GUID is: {72631e54-78a4-11d0-bcf7-00aa00b7b32a}. For Windows OS: Hardware ID: HID: HID\VID_051D&PID_0002&REV_0090 HID\VID_051D&PID_0002 HID_DEVICE_UP:0084_U:0004 HID_DEVICE HID: HID\VID_051D&PID_0002&REV_0006 ...
Arch Linux Man Pages
man.archlinux.org › man › usbhid-ups.8.en
usbhid-ups(8) — Arch manual pages
For example, for CPS PR1000LCDRTXL2U model, the only allowed values are [60,55,50,45,40,35,30,25,20] and in some cases, your UPS may effectively not support a value of 10 for the battery.charge.low setting. This driver, formerly called newhidups, replaces the legacy hidups driver, which only ...
Powerinspired
powerinspired.com › home › knowledgebase › ups hid compliant usb interface
UPS HID Compliant USB Interface - Uninterruptible Power Supplies
October 15, 2025 - Sometimes HID-class UPS devices only trigger “Critical battery” notifications, skipping “Low battery.” You can verify this: Go to Control Panel → Power Options → UPS (if available) Check if “Low battery” and “Critical battery” levels are configurable · If not, the UPS driver doesn’t expose them — hibernation will still trigger when critical is reached.
Revert Service
revertservice.com › 7 › hidbatt
HID UPS Battery Driver (HidBatt) Service Defaults in Windows 7
Hid Battery Driver by Microsoft Corporation. HID UPS Battery Driver is a kernel device driver. In Windows 7 it won't be started if the user doesn't start it. If HID UPS Battery Driver fails to start, Windows 7 attempts to write the failure details into Event Log.
DriverIdentifier
driveridentifier.com › scan › hid-ups-battery › driver-detail › 5B1BAB8186A346DE8749404A3F1D285F › 3053344 › ec767fa4e69d7f3bf236ba40c20f8cab › 246852720 › HID_DEVICE_UP:0084_U:0004
HID UPS Battery Driver Download For XP,VISTA,WIN7,WIN8,WIN10/64bits - Hewlett-Packard H8-1380t
Download Latest HID UPS Battery driver for windows 7, vista,xp,windows8 . it's for H8-1380t
Outbyte
outbyte.com › home › driver database › input devices › microsoft › hid ups battery
Download Microsoft HID UPS Battery drivers
November 24, 2025 - Download Battery drivers for Windows, that can help resolve Microsoft HID UPS Battery PC issues.
Driver Talent
drivethelife.com › home › microsoft input devices driver
HID UPS Battery Drivers Download for Free | Driver Talent
You can download and update all HID UPS Battery drivers for free on this page. Choose a proper version according to your system information and click download button to quickly download the needed driver.
Reddit
reddit.com › r/linux › reverse engineering ups battery status usb hid protocol with linux
r/linux on Reddit: Reverse engineering UPS battery status USB HID protocol with Linux
November 8, 2025 -
I had some fun this week with the UPS I installed to keep my Internet running in case of a power outage. I wanted to somehow monitor its status, without getting into third party tools, software, etc.
In the end, I managed to extract the data of interest with an ancient Raspberry Pi 2B and latest mainline Linux. With a tiny bit of userspace coding on top, that's all I needed!
I hope in general that the whole experience above of reverse engineering the USB HID-based protocols is useful to you.
Top answer 1 of 3
39
It's an interesting thing to do, and I applaud you for doing it... but the NUT software has supported this UPS for quite a while, AFAIK. https://www.reddit.com/r/homelab/comments/lzelya/working_nut_config_for_cyberpower_ups/
2 of 3
5
My favorite report descriptor parser: https://eleccelerator.com/usbdescreqparser/ My tool for messing around with HID devices from a (Chromium-based) web browser: https://nondebug.github.io/webhid-explorer/ I wish the HID usage tables had an official HTML version instead of putting everything in a PDF. https://usb.org/document-library/hid-usage-tables-16
Ten Forums
tenforums.com › drivers-hardware › 207096-windows-hid-ups-battery-device-hibernating-98-battery-left.html
Windows HID UPS Battery device hibernating with 98% of battery left. - Windows 10 Help Forums
I am running Windows 10 22H2 OS Build 19045.3324 on an HP G2 SFF desktop PC. It is powered by an APC Back UPS BE550G-CN and I am using the stock Windows HID UPS Battery device driver. I had the critical battery level set to 5% (for both AC and battery) and the critical battery action set to hibernate (for both AC and battery).
Powervar
powervar.com › - › media › ametekpowervar › pdf › resources › connectivity-solutions-support-files › upmii-connectivity-hid-battery › security-ii---connectivity---power-managemnt-integration.pdf pdf
Windows Power Management Integration via USB HID‐ ...
HID‐UPS Battery. ... USB or RS232. ... © AMETEK Powervar | 1450 S. Lakeside Drive | Waukegan, IL 60085 | 847.596.7000 | powervar.com | cservice.powervar@ametek.com ... Power Options utilities via native Windows drivers.